Constantine Karathanasis (PhD 2022 and Lecturer at Texas A&M University) has won a fellowship at the Center for Hellenic Studies in Washington, DC for Spring 2024. Dr. Karathanasis will spend his fellowship semester continuing work on the subject of his dissertation, “Enter Homo Oeconomicus: Civic Motivation and Civic Education in Aristophanic Comedy.”
